FLIR P660 – GPS Enabled, High Definition Infrared Camera

The FLIR P660 uses an advanced, highly-sensitive detector for non-contact scanning across wide areas. Camera controls and software make it easy to quickly scan for emissivity and object temperature differences that can signal trouble in electrical systems and infrastructure.

New technologies in the P660, such as an advanced infrared detector, embedded Geographic Positioning System (GPS), remote control and greater image accuracy help you scan conditions that signal trouble.

Differentiating Features

• Tag your infrared images with FLIR’s GPS and Google Earth to save time.
• Make IR surveys more convenient and safe through WLAN remote control and display.
• Choose full FLIR Fusion detail to see all the faulty spots inside visible light images.
• Fine-tune IR images with Dynamic Details Enhancement (DDE).
• Capture high-quality visible light images with the 3.2 megapixel camera and lamp.

You’ll spend less time documenting and explaining where the trouble is. The FLIR embedded GPS automatically documents satellite coordinates for you so you concentrate more on your work. 

Forget standing too close to trouble. Mount the P660 and use the colour display and wireless LAN remote to control the camera across terrain, facilities and harsh environments.

Many times IR images need to be enhanced. DDE is an exclusive feature to the P660 based on technology developed by FLIR for government use. 

When you need to add infrared detail anywhere inside a visible light image, use FLIR’s full Fusion features and create information-packed images. Advanced FLIR Image Fusion gives you greater flexibility to show trouble spots, so they are not overlooked when they need to be fixed. Choose rectangular Picture In Picture (PIP) or show IR detail of objects in the fused images.

The P660’s high-resolution auto focus camera and powerful target illuminator/lamp help you create the best fusion images possible.
